/** modal **/
.modal {
  width: 600px;
}

@media print, screen and (max-width: 64em) {
  .modal {
    width: calc(100vw - 40px);
  }
}

/** modal **/

/** modal popup-inquiry **/
select:disabled {
  opacity: 1;
  color: black !important;
  background-image: none;
}
/** modal popup-inquiry **/
/** popup-video-meeting **/
#ui-datepicker-div {
  background-color: #fff;
}
/** popup-video-meeting **/
/** popup-consult-exhibitor-info **/
.user-info input {
  width: 100%;
}

.form-group {
  margin-bottom: 10px;
  display: flex;
  align-items: center;
}

.user-info button#goPage {
  margin: 0;
}
/** popup-consult-exhibitor-info **/

/** popup-consult-buyer-info **/
.user-info input {
  width: 100%;
}

.form-group {
  margin-bottom: 10px;
  display: flex;
  align-items: center;
}

.user-info button#goPage {
  margin: 0;
}
/** popup-consult-buyer-info **/

/** popup-consult-status **/
.es-radio label {
  display: flex;
  align-items: center;
}

.pcs-s {
  width: 100%;
  margin: auto;
  margin-top: 40px;
  display: flex;
  justify-content: center;
}

.user-info .justify-cen {
  display: flex;
  justify-content: center;
}

.memo-block {
  display: flex;
  width: 100%;
  margin-top: 10px;
}

.memo-block > label {
  display: flex;
  align-items: center;
  width: 150px;
}

.memo-block > div {
  width: calc(100% - 150px);
  height: 60px;
}

.memo-block > div.mdc-text-field--textarea .mdc-text-field__input {
  padding-top: 10px;
}

/** popup-consult-status **/
